The fifth international and interdisciplinary art methods school Living in the Landscape (LiLa) took place in 2024. This series of schools is organized by the University of Arctic’s thematic network Arctic Sustainable Art and Design (ASAD). This year (2024) we undertook our hybrid delivery of online collaboration with locally situated task activity in each country; coupled with intensive feldworking in situ in the hydro and ‘green’ energ yriverscapes of Finnish Lapland.
This collection of essays offers comment here on our Lila (2024) as a celebration of the fow of ideas, understandings and activity.
